Output 391a31a1609b142901f9fd265f3ebff07a515b51a67e0d06f51a2bc685796a7e:1

value
5192000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1edacd301155704195667c491bc7991d42431af2 OP_EQUAL
address
34WAJtq7CTLdAVvdpDZ3Nqxy97qG8PxBrv
transaction
391a31a1609b142901f9fd265f3ebff07a515b51a67e0d06f51a2bc685796a7e
confirmations
293885
spent
true